i-want-great-care-logo.pngThe cost of a Psychiatrist's consultation can vary, it could range from $150 to $500 per session. The first session will be more expensive, since it involves an initial psychiatric assessment. This may include taking vitals as well as ordering lab tests, psychological testing or addressing other concerns. The next sessions will be less costly and will focus more on managing your medication.

If you're not insured and need to pay for an appointment with a psychiatrist could be quite expensive. However certain private practice psychiatrists offer sliding scale rates based on a patient's ability to pay. These services can be especially beneficial to those with financial difficulties.

Another way to lower the cost of a psychiatric appointment is to visit an in-network psychiatrist. In-network providers are contracted by your health insurance company and will bill them at less. Check with your insurance company to find out which hospitals and clinics are in-network.
